First, we arrived at Tumaren Camp, the base for Karisia Walking Safaris, where safaris unfold entirely on foot. This is not your typical game drive. Here, we followed lion tracks, moved silently through the acacia bush, dined under impossibly close stars, and journeyed on camels. We also tried our hand at rock climbing, adding an adventurous twist to the experience. The wildlife sightings were exhilarating, but what stood out was the lightness of our footprint. Karisia’s ethos is grounded in minimal environmental impact and maximum community involvement. Their Samburu guides — wildlife experts and custodians of the land — brought a deeper connection to the safari, making it feel personal and profoundly meaningful.

Next, we travelled to El Karama Lodge, where the philosophy that “small is beautiful” truly comes to life. This intimate, family-run lodge redefines the safari experience. It’s not just the incredible game drives and private excursions that stand out — El Karama also fosters a profound connection to the land. Meals are prepared using ingredients grown on-site, flowers from the garden decorate your plate, and the lodge actively involves the local community, from children joining in Bush School baking sessions to team members who hail from nearby villages. The lodge’s stunning Nilotica Private House became our peaceful base for slow mornings and starlit storytelling. Ahnasa’s expert curation was evident here — they had introduced me to a place where luxury and sustainability coexist in perfect harmony.

What sets El Karama and Karisia apart — and what made my experience so unique — is the collaborative spirit running through Laikipia’s privately owned conservancies. Here, lodge owners work together, not for personal gain, but to regenerate the region. This collective effort supports conservation, local communities, and the ecosystems of Laikipia in equal measure.

Take their approach to wildlife, for example. Ahnasa supports organisations like Ulinzi Africa Foundation, training rangers to protect wildlife corridors across Kenya. It’s small organisations like this — locally led and rooted in co-existence — that need support, and it’s here that Ahnasa’s guests can see the tangible impact of their travel.

Then there’s their community work, which struck a chord with me. Hearing Phera speak about supporting a Maasai women-led initiative tackling water and food insecurity was one of those moments that reminds you why travel can — and should — be a force for good. And it’s not just big-picture. At places like El Karama, you feel it in the details: the team proudly from nearby villages, the Bush School where children bake with visiting families, the way guests are gently invited into — not merely observers of — the rhythm of daily life.

Even their environmental ethos is refreshingly practical. Ahnasa partners only with lodges and experiences that are genuinely walking the walk: solar-powered setups, local sourcing, and low-impact operations. And every trip includes a built-in conservation donation, matched by Ahnasa themselves. Quiet impact, made easy.
